Output 23b4287a37a966bbfed73060b2596ff41ce3fed7534d2ecd9376687eeee754ed:3

value
56188483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 856debd73bfffe2807b4c64678e4d9134723d1bc OP_EQUAL
address
3DrXUX6h1AkcPwyJs15LRBwcYJwhuqt627
transaction
23b4287a37a966bbfed73060b2596ff41ce3fed7534d2ecd9376687eeee754ed
spent
true